Group Health Insurance

Many insurance companies do cover acupuncture, chiropractic and massage. Our clinic is on many insurance panels in Oregon, and Christine works successfully with Personal Injury Protection for acupuncture benefits. Go to your insurance company web site or call the number listed on your card for further information. You will want to get specific answers to the following questions:

Is acupuncture, chiropractic or massage a covered benefit on my current insurance plan?

What is my total benefit (i.e. how many treatments per year, or dollar amount)?

What is my deductible?

Have I met any of that deductible this year?

Another option is to simply bring in your insurance card to your first visit. With the information on your card and your birth date we can call the insurance company and get that information for you.

Motor Vehicle Accident?

Please note: if you have been in an automobile accident within the last 12 months and are currently undergoing physical therapy or other medical care for injuries sustained in the accident - you can use your PIP benefits for acupuncture and chiropractic. What's more, you do not need a referral to do so.

Work Related Injury?

If you have a new work injury and have not seen another medical provider, our office can see you without a referral. However, if you are under the care of another physician, we would need a referral from their office to see you.
